AstraNode / relay-node program

The spacecraft at the edge of the network.

AstraNode is Argentora’s autonomous relay-node program: a compact spacecraft architecture for receiving, storing, routing, and forwarding data while AstraShift coordinates the wider network.

Optical
Forward and aft relay terminals
Autonomy
Local navigation and constrained decision support
Mobility
Modular power and electric propulsion

Why now

Static routing fails when the network itself moves.

Optical links can move more data, while narrow beams can reduce interception risk. But weather and line of sight can break a route without warning, and orbital assets make that geometry change continuously.

AstraShift is the coordination layer: it evaluates available paths, aligns moving assets, and helps operators keep the network useful as conditions change.
